Samson Siasia banned for life from football over Bribery

 

Former Super Eagle Coach, Samson Siasia has been banned for life from football and all football related activities for bribery and match fixing, on Friday, 16th August.

 

Samson Siasia was found guilty and banned by the Independent Ethnic Committee. He violated the FIFA Code of Ethnics.


In its decision, the adjudicatory chamber found that Mr Siasia had breached art 11(Bribery) of the 2009 edition of the FIFA Code of Ethics and banned him for life from all football-related activities(administrative, sports and any other) at both national and international level.
